OAKLAND, CA – Today marks the start of Grandparents' Week at Children's Fairyland in Oakland. Through Saturday, grandparents will receive free admission to the park when they are accompanied by their grandchild.

The park will be open each day from 10 a.m. until 4 p.m., weather permitting, closed Dec. 31 and Jan. 1.

Since 1950, Fairyland has stood as a Bay Area destination for those with youngsters -- a fantasy environment for play and imagination with fairy tales, performing arts, animals, and unique children's programming focused on early childhood education and literacy.
